One of those frustrating rides into work.

It's that time of year where sun is directly in my eyes into work and on the way home, which makes it a struggle to see well, despite the sun visor. It also means that drivers are struggling to see and don't want to use their mirrors as much.

The M6 was clogged up. With me not being 100% confident I was seeing how close I was to cars and with cars not seeing me it was a real pain filtering through traffic, made worse with a prick on a tiger with a private plate cutting me up then blocking me. Tosser.

Re: What did you do to your bike today ??

Post by Blade »

Put some 1/2 inch thick black tape across the very top of the visor. Virtually zero effect on your field of view but will block out that annoying low level sun just above the eye level.

2 second fix and easily removed if not effective.

Worth a try (y)
